The "It Used to be a Gypsy Caravan camp."
Once, a while back, a family of gypsies moved to Port La Forks and set up a fortune telling business. They built a small camp of their caravans but quickly realized that the rainy (and cold) didn't suit well to having to walk through the open muddy field to get to their room or the bathhouse (okay, bath caravan) -- so they built covered walkways between each caravan -- and then they built a great room to gather in (since you can't really sit outside at a campfire when its pouring).
This is a shot of the two of the caravans and the great room (and a long hall). yes, I know -- its a really odd lot.
